Unleashing performance through advanced materials

Motorsport composites, such as carbon fibre reinforced polymers (CFRPs), offer unparalleled strength-to-weight ratios, providing a competitive edge on the track. These innovative materials are now extensively used in the construction of various vehicle components, including chassis, body panels, and aerodynamic devices. By reducing weight and improving rigidity, composites can enhance acceleration, manoeuvrability, and overall stability, resulting in improved lap times and cornering abilities.

Safety advancements driven by composites

In addition to boosting performance, motorsport composites have contributed significantly to enhancing driver safety. The energy absorption capabilities of CFRPs enable them to better withstand impacts, reducing the risk of severe injuries during high-speed crashes. These materials dissipate crash forces more efficiently and maintain structural integrity, providing drivers with enhanced protection.

Future Trends

As technology advances, motorsport composites continue to evolve, resulting in further optimisation of vehicle performance. The integration of 3D printing in composite manufacturing is gaining traction, enabling the production of complex, lightweight structures with increased efficiency. Furthermore, the development of self-healing composites and bio-based materials indicates a move toward sustainable innovation in motorsport.
